Cap·ri·cor·nus

 (kăp′rĭ-kôr′nəs)
n.
A constellation in the equatorial region of the Southern Hemisphere, near Aquarius and Sagittarius. Also called Capricorn, Goat.

Capricornus

(ˌkæprɪˈkɔːnəs)
n, Latin genitive -ni (-naɪ)
(Astronomy) a faint zodiacal constellation in the S hemisphere, lying between Sagittarius and Aquarius
